Transaction 622c86e4e267070b369cfbd1546a5b988d157fd0ed747917c0c476a3cd5f101c

2 Input
2 Outputs
  • 622c86e4e267070b369cfbd1546a5b988d157fd0ed747917c0c476a3cd5f101c:0
  • value  3776391
    address  17p1rUShkoSbGgTGpps2NvW6DkyPuSbWxW
  • 622c86e4e267070b369cfbd1546a5b988d157fd0ed747917c0c476a3cd5f101c:1
  • value  25586684
    address  366CLkN4YCJmuF11WVacz19xicy3iYRRVj